W. N. P. BARBELLION




Admired by H. G. Wells and Raymond Queneau, likened to Joyce and Kafka and hailed as the author of 'the greatest diary a man has written', W. N. P. Barbellion (1889-1919) is paradoxically a neglected figure, unknown to most readers and overlooked by most histories of English literature. The present website, consisting of extracts from my book The Quotable Barbellion, aims at rectifying this situation.
